Defensive Pillars With Offensive Flair
Jordan Pickford – 8/10
The Everton keeper’s two crucial saves (including a spectacular one-on-one denial) preserved the clean sheet when the game was still competitive. His distribution launched several attacks, proving he’s more than just a shot-stopper.
Ben Chilwell – 9/10
The left-back redefined modern fullback play with three assists – a feat no England defender had achieved in a decade. His pinpoint crosses from open play and set pieces dismantled Montenegro’s defense systematically.

Midfield Maestros Controlling Tempo
Harry Winks – 8/10
The metronome at the base of midfield completed 95.5% of his passes, dictating England‘s rhythm. His visionary through-ball to Sancho in the first half deserved an assist.
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ain – 8/10
Liverpool’s in-form midfielder translated his club confidence to international level, scoring the opener with a composed finish and creating chances throughout.

Attacking Fireworks
Harry Kane – 9/10
The captain’s perfect hat-trick (left foot, right foot, header) took his tally to 9 goals in 5 games. His movement and finishing were textbook examples of center-forward play.
Jadon Sancho – 8/10
The young winger terrorized Montenegro’s defense with his dribbling, eventually assisting Abraham’s goal. His performance justified Southgate’s continued faith in youth.
Marcus Rashford – 8/10
Despite some missed chances, Rashford’s direct running and powerful finish showcased his growing maturity in an England shirt.

Impact Substitutes
Tammy Abraham – 8/10
The Chelsea striker’s well-taken first international goal highlighted England‘s attacking depth. His positioning and finish suggest he’ll push Kane harder than any previous understudy.
